Comprehensive readouts of cellular states produced by genome-scale experimental platforms, such as
Next-Generation Sequencing (NGS) and various microarray/BeadArray platforms, have become indispensible
in studying effects and interactions of genetic, epigenetic and environmental factors. Management, analysis
and interpretation of genomics data generated by these platforms, and "omics" data in general, require
advanced computational platforms and analytical approaches. The increasing scale and complexity of
genome-wide assays dramatically raise the need for systems biology integration and interpretation of such
data, as well as the overall importance of bioinformatics in biomedical research. Advanced bioinformatics
methods are also being increasingly used to elucidate functional consequences of mutations, model
biomolecular interactions, such as those between toxicants and their targets, or create general mathematical
models of complex biological systems. The methods and algorithms used in these analyses are underpinned
by mathematical and statistical models of growing complexity. The breath of bioinformatics methods used in
modern Environmental Health research necessitates involvement of experts in different areas of bioinformatics.
Finding the right expertise sometimes requires going beyond boundaries of individual Environmental Health
Sciences (EHS) Core Centers and individual institutions.
The computational tools used in bioinformatics are built on mathematical, statistical and algorithmic
foundations that are often inaccessible to biomedical researchers, creating a pressing need for assistance in all
stages of generating, managing and analyzing genomic data sets. The Bioinformatics Core (BC) provides
unique services that have in the past been extensively used by CEG investigators. It is reasonable to expect
that CEG investigators will increasingly rely on BC in navigating ever changing landscape of massive datasets,
quickly evolving technologies, and multitude of algorithms and computational platforms for data analysis. In
addition to using existing state-of-the-art methods, BC members will develop innovative methods for analysis of
genomics data and resources for leveraging the public domain genomics data. Through the network of internal
and external Bioinformatics consultants, BC will facilitate the access to resources and expertise otherwise not
accessible to CEG investigators. BC will also play an important integrative role for the CEG and beyond by
centralizing management and facilitating access to genomics data handled by BC.
